GOCCs’ dividends reach P116.8 billion

MANILA – Government-owned and -controlled corporations (GOCCs) have remitted a whopping PHP116.84 billion in dividends to the National Treasury as of September this year, the Department of Finance (DOF) reported Tuesday during the 2025 GOCCs’ Day rites in Malacañang. The dividends came from 53 GOCCs, with 15 remitting at least PHP1 billion each. The Land…

Final tranche of SCTEX toll rate hike starts Sept. 9

MANILA – The third and final tranche of toll rate adjustments for the Subic-Clark-Tarlac Expressway (SCTEX) will begin on Sept. 9. The Toll Regulatory Board (TRB) has authorized the additional 64 centavos per kilometer for Class 1 vehicles (cars, jeepneys, vans, pickups and motorcycles); PHP1.29 per kilometer for Class 2 (larger sports utility vehicles and with…
